Jadavpur University Post Master Diploma Medical Physics Fees

Jadavpur University Post Master Diploma Medical Physics fees 2025 is ₹ 84,000 for the entire course duration.

Earlier, Post Master Diploma Medical Physics fees at Jadavpur University was ₹ 84,000 (in 2022) for the entire course duration. This shows that the fee has remained unchanged since 2022.

Which is better for competitive programming: Jadavpur University or IIEST, Shibpur?

Aditya BoseStudied at Indian Institute of Engineering Science and Technology, Shibpur

Any college can be good for competitive programming. It all relies on you to educate yourself, to learn new strategies, and to spend hours coding. 

  • Anudeep Nekkanti is one such example. He was recruited by Google and qualified for ACM ICPC world finals. If you look at the name of his college, it's not one of those elite ones. 
  • There was no competitive programming pattern in BESU/IIEST until recently. But many students have taken competitive programming platforms such as Codechef and HackerRank over the last few years.
  • You can search the Codechef Rating System site to verify it for yourself. You get a college-wise database of the number of students actively engaged in competitive coding and their results using this platform.

Lastly, don't support the myth that the only way to prove yourself as a coder is competitive programming. There are other coding fields as well. In this sense, do not consider that there was no "real coder" in IIEST because there was no competitive coding pattern previously in IIEST (BESU back then). 

Some of the alumni of the institute are working in top companies in India and overseas and have never been interested in competitive coding.
